Many very nice buildings, beautiful pools, lakes and etc. The only really BIG problem is the roads in the park. We pull a 37' fifth wheel that I was surprised wasn't damaged. Very steep drives full of deep ruts, pot holes and dirt roads and poorly marked directions. We stayed three days but until they pave the roads we will not be back.

This is a private resort. You can't stay here unless your a member or buy an RV from St Louis Dealers. Stayed here 3 times a week at a time. Great amenities: 2 indoor pools, hot tub, an outdoor pool, tennis courts, movie theater, game room, large gymnasium, activity center, indoor miniature golf, boat rentals and fishing. Road inside Resort suck! Campground is not good for large 5th wheels or Class A motor homes. Pads are gravel with many being very soft and narrow. Few pads are level. Best sites have no shade. Best thing about the Campground is it has a very nice club and shower house.

This is one if those membership resorts, so you never really know what you're going to get. Yes, rv parking is at the top of a steep and narrow hill. But there are amenities **galore**, a restaurant, and it was well maintained. We'll definitely be back and stay longer.
